Investigator (Hybrid)
California Department of Health Care Services (DHCS) seeks an Investigator to conduct full criminal and civil investigations into fraud and misconduct against the California Medical Assistance Program (Medi‑Cal) and related state programs. Investigators are peace officers under California Penal Code Section 830.3(h) and typically work field‑based assignments, spending at least 90% of their time outdoors.
Responsibilities- Conduct thorough investigations, including gathering evidence, interviewing witnesses, and analyzing facts.
- Maintain proficiency with a firearm and wear plain clothes with concealed carry as required.
- Analyze situations accurately, draw valid conclusions, and take effective action under stressful conditions.
- Travel throughout California as business requires while treating all individuals with respect and impartiality.
See classification specification for full details. Candidates must meet all minimum qualifications (education, experience and a Section 830.3(h) peace officer status) and must be able to pass a drug screening, background investigation, medical clearance, and, if necessary, a psychological evaluation.
